But given the Mavericks' situation, it seems pretty clear what the smart course of action will be in the coming three weeks. Mark Cuban knows what it is -- and knows that the 29 other NBA teams know what it is, too.

First, remember that they have about $13 million in salary-cap space for this season. So they can take on new salary without any real penalty, other than a lot of Benjamins out of Cuban's wallet.

With that in mind, the prudent route is to take on players -- even if they carry larger salary obligations than the Mavericks would like -- provided the Mavericks also can get prime assets in return.

"I would say we are looking to use our cap space actively," Cuban said Monday. "We will take back salary to get picks or guys we think can play."

This doesn't mean you should expect a blockbuster before the deadline. But the kindling wood for a bonfire is in place. And don't be surprised if you hear a lot of speculation between now and then.

With a 15-29 record, the playoffs are a pipe dream for this team. And while some pipe dreams come true, making a run at .500, which is what it will take (at least) to qualify for the playoffs, seems slim if not impossible.
